Osterloth, Bekkum at convention

On Oct. 2-4, more than 200 retired educators gathered at The Osthoff Resort in Elkhart Lake to attend the convention of the Wisconsin Retired Educators' Association.
Paul Wesselmann, The Ripples Guy, was the keynote speaker who unleashed an infusion of energy and insight for convention attendees.
Chris Gleason, 2016-2017 Wisconsin Teacher of the Year representative shred how he is "lighting a fire in kids" through music.
Delegates from the Barron County Rirred Educators' Association included John Osterloth of Rice Lake and Victor Bekkum of Cumberland.  Osterloth serves on the WREA Board of Directors as chair of the WREA Member Benefits committee, and Bekkum is the Past President of WREA.  The group is a non-partisan, independent organization with more than 10,500 members statewide and 65 local units.  For details about BCREA, contact Kathy Duerr at 715-924-2120.
